Biography

Ayllene Gibbons, a talented actress, entered this world on February 23, 1906, in the charming town of Poplar Bluff, Missouri, USA. This gifted thespian would go on to leave an indelible mark on the world of cinema, captivating audiences with her remarkable performances in a plethora of films. Some of her most notable roles include her appearances in the 1965 film "The Loved One", the 1963 horror classic "House of the Damned", and the 1966 thriller "Chamber of Horrors". Throughout her illustrious career, Ayllene Gibbons consistently demonstrated her impressive range and versatility as an actress, earning her a special place in the hearts of fans and critics alike. Unfortunately, her time on this earth came to an end on October 18, 1987, in Houston, Texas, USA, leaving behind a legacy that would be remembered for generations to come.
